## Configuration

The Korvid SDKs (Rust and Kotlin) share a parity matrix; check `PARITY.md` before using streaming calls, which Kotlin lacks until v0.9. Both clients read the same `.env` file, so configure once. Region and timeout defaults match. To enable authenticated requests, add the following line to your `.env`:

sealed setting: VAULT_KEY20=c8ea1e419912889df6b4

**Q: What happens when Mailcull marks a bounce as permanent?**

Mailcull, our email bounce processor, classifies hard bounces after three consecutive failures and suppresses the address automatically. Soft bounces are retried for 72 hours. If the suppression list itself becomes corrupted, restore it from the encrypted nightly snapshot in the Thornfield backup bucket. Restoring requires the team recovery passphrase, which is kept directly below this entry for emergencies.

unlock words, kahof-bahap: praax-ulaix

Validator plugins for the Thornquist pipeline are loaded at startup from the plugin registry service, Ossifrage. Each plugin declares a schema version; mismatches are quarantined rather than dropped, and quarantined batches surface on the Brindlemoor dashboard within five minutes. For the weekly sync, note that re-registering a plugin requires an authenticated call to the Ossifrage admin endpoint, and the registration job must present the internal service key, which appears below.

service key, fawip-bajef: kto11_Qt5wZK9vdNC

Team — as part of archiving the cold storage buckets under Project Driftvault, all legacy credentials are being rotated tonight. The old Glacierbin key stops working at cutover; any review jobs still referencing it will fail. Archival manifests move to the new read-only tier, and the sweep script has been updated in the pending PR. Please approve before 18:00 so the cron picks it up. The replacement key for the Glacierbin internal API is below.

API key for kafop-fafof: qvz3-4pw